Position Summary:
The Senior Program Associate serves as a member of The Philanthropic Initiative’s (TPI) professional staff, focusing primarily on supporting programmatic and strategic planning work for TPI clients and projects. This individual works collaboratively as a member of teams supporting specific TPI client engagements in designing, developing, managing and evaluating philanthropic programs and strategic plans; supporting client relationships; and researching philanthropic issues. The Senior Program Associate assumes increasing levels of project management responsibility for selected projects and programs. This individual also provides occasional support to TPI marketing, strategic planning, communications and business development efforts.
Essential Functions:
Support clients and TPI project teams, working directly with clients on certain projects;
Provide project management support and facilitate client meetings;
Prepare briefing papers and other materials to support client needs including research and analysis of social issues, best practices, and model approaches;
Conduct benchmarking research and community needs assessments;
Identify and present funding opportunities, including ideas for programmatic initiatives;
Provide ongoing management and support for programs and projects, including scholarship programs, college success programs and other programs that TPI manages on behalf of clients;
Conduct due diligence on grant proposals, review funding requests, track, monitor and evaluate funded projects, and conduct site visits with or on behalf of clients;
Provide support for strategic planning and facilitation, including designing and implementing surveys of key stakeholders and grant recipients; interviewing key stakeholders; compiling materials for strategic planning projects; and assisting with preparation for planning sessions/retreats with clients; and
Plan and coordinate events, including events connected with corporate volunteer programs, college success programs, and grantee convenings.

The Philanthropic Initiative (TPI) helps companies, foundations, families and individuals find innovative ways to maximize the impact of their giving. Working around the globe, we partner with clients to create, implement and evaluate customized philanthropic strategies. Since 1989, we've directed more than one billion philanthropic dollars and influenced billions more on behalf of our clients.
TPI is also committed to actively promoting and advancing strategic philanthropy. We conduct cutting edge research and train individuals, organizations, and advisors in best practices. Through TPI’s Center for Global Philanthropy, we partner with experts, government and nonprofit leaders to build cultures and systems that embrace and support effective social investing. Our promotional work informs our advising work - to the benefit of our clients and the global philanthropy community.
The Philanthropic Initiative is an operating unit of the Boston Foundation.
